'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2' To Feature 'Dragon Ball Super' Content?

"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" may have content from the franchise's current anime show "Dragon Ball Super." The game's producer made the announcement at E3 2016.

Yibada reported that "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" producer Masayuki Hirano has revealed his hopes on adding content from "Dragon Ball Super" to the game. Apparently, Bandai Namco is already planning to adapt content from the anime series.

"Since Dragon Ball Super is still playing we are hoping to add those characters and features into the game," he told Siliconera in an interview at E3 2016. "As you can imagine, it takes a long time to create a character. It may be before the game is released, it may be after. To be candid, we're just starting to look into it."

Hirano also shared that the "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" team is planning to support the game with free updates. Paid DLC may also be available after it gets released.

The "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" release date is expected to happen later this year. The highly-anticipated game will be published for PS4, Xbox One and PC.

According to Day Herald, the fighting game will most likely include some skins or characters from the show. However, it is unlikely that "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" will incorporate the story of the series since development has already started before "Dragon Ball Super" aired.

Tech Times noted that "Dragon Ball Xenoverse 2" will have a character customization system again, with added options. New characters for the game as of the moment are Turles from "Dragon Ball Z: The Tree of Might" movie and Future Gohan.

Ki blasts now arc in the air, previously it flew straight forward. Two new types of dashes have also been introduced: a Homing Dash and an Aura Burst Dash.

The Homing Dash is a quicker form of dash. An Aura Burst Dash allows players to dodge attacks while approaching the enemy. The latter may cost users Ki or extra stamina, though.
